The Program and Institutional Funding Manager (PIFM) will work within a global fundraising team with members in the UK and Africa.

The role is responsible for securing income from institutional donors (including governments, multi-lateral banks, agencies and major foundations), developing and managing strong and mutually beneficial relationships with funding partners, and delivering timely, insightful reports.

You will work with Country Directors to shape business development plans, including identifying and prioritising potential partners and donors.

Strong written and spoken English language skills are essential and proficiency in local languages, particularly French, are desirable.

About Us

Established in 1988 (as Send a Cow), Ripple Effect is a dynamic and passionate international development charity on a mission to create a powerful and lasting impact. Our vision is to see a rural Africa that is confident, thriving, and sustainable, with a growing economy and higher living standards for all. At Ripple Effect, we've honed our focus on three critical areas: Sustainable Agriculture, Gender and Social Inclusion, and Enterprise Development. Through these pillars, we're dedicated to combating poverty and nurturing a vibrant, thriving African landscape that will thrive for generations to come.
